I need integrate the Cisco Call Manager with a Cisco Call Manager Express. Do I need to do the following tasks?

* In the CCME add a new dial-peer type voip, with the session target the IP Address of the Call Manager.

* In the CCM add this CME as H.323 Gateway and create a new Route Pattern.

I was under the impression that better results are possible defining CME as inter-cluster trunk, not GW.

This is a pretty common misconception. It will mostly work, and you probably won't have any problems. But, there's a high probability for some weird issues to come up, and some unexpected results.

It's easier to think of it like this:

H323 intercluster trunk: Cisco proprietary H323 (only between CCMs)

H323 gateway: ITU specification H.323

H323 intercluster GK controlled: Cisco proprietary h323 with a GK in the middle. CCM-GK-CCM

CME doesn't run any of the proprietary H323 information that CCM uses.

i fix the problem.

just put this command : h323-gateway voip bind srcaddr int the interface on the ccme.
